Quando si tratta di lavorare con database SQL, è fondamentale essere in grado di ottimizzare le prestazioni delle query per garantire una rapida e efficiente elaborazione dei dati. Ci sono diversi metodi che possono essere utilizzati per migliorare le prestazioni delle query e ottenere risultati più veloci e accurati.
Gli indici sono uno strumento potente per migliorare le prestazioni delle query. Creare gli indici sulle colonne utilizzate frequentemente nelle query consente al database di recuperare i dati più rapidamente. È importante identificare le colonne chiave e creare gli indici appropriati per migliorare le prestazioni delle query.
Selezionare solo i record necessari può migliorare significativamente le prestazioni delle query. Utilizzare clausole come LIMIT o TOP per limitare il numero di record restituiti e ridurre il tempo di esecuzione delle query.
Le subquery possono essere molto utili, ma possono anche rallentare le prestazioni delle query. Se possibile, cercare di riscrivere le subquery come join per migliorare le prestazioni.
Le clausole WHERE sono fondamentali per filtrare i dati desiderati, ma possono anche influire sulle prestazioni delle query. Utilizzare gli operatori logici e gli indici in modo efficace per ottimizzare le clausole WHERE e migliorare le prestazioni delle query.
Le statistiche del database forniscono informazioni sulle tabelle e le colonne utilizzate nelle query. Aggiornare regolarmente le statistiche del database può aiutare il sistema a prendere decisioni più intelligenti sull'ottimizzazione delle query e migliorare le prestazioni complessive.
L'utilizzo del carattere jolly (*) all'inizio di una query può causare rallentamenti delle prestazioni. Specificare solo le colonne necessarie nella clausola SELECT per evitare di caricare dati inutili e migliorare le prestazioni.
È importante monitorare costantemente le prestazioni delle query per identificare i punti deboli e apportare le modifiche necessarie. Utilizzare strumenti di monitoraggio delle prestazioni del database per individuare le query lente e apportare le opportune ottimizzazioni.
Migliorare le prestazioni delle query è fondamentale per garantire un'elaborazione efficiente dei dati nei database SQL. Utilizzando gli indici, limitando il numero di record restituiti, evitando le subquery e ottimizzando le clausole WHERE, è possibile ottenere risultati più veloci e accurati. Aggiornare regolarmente le statistiche del database e monitorare le prestazioni delle query sono anche passaggi importanti per migliorare continuamente le prestazioni del database.
Commenti (0)